THS Outstanding Shares Analysis

What is the Trend in THS`s Outstanding Shares?

Treehouse Foods`s outstanding shares have decreased by approximately -2.05% annually over the past 5 years (Correlation: -90.0%), positively influencing the share price.

Has Treehouse Foods ever had a Stock Split?

No Stock Splits found.
Year Number of Shares Annual Growth Rate
2004 31,060,000
2005 31,190,000 +0.42%
2006 31,313,000 +0.39%
2007 31,308,000 -0.02%
2008 32,343,000 +3.31%
2009 34,614,000 +7.02%
2010 36,785,000 +6.27%
2011 37,094,000 +0.84%
2012 37,137,000 +0.12%
2013 37,565,000 +1.15%
2014 43,385,000 +15.49%
2015 43,844,000 +1.06%
2016 56,825,000 +29.61%
2017 57,200,000 +0.66%
2018 56,000,000 -2.1%
2019 56,600,000 +1.07%
2020 56,500,000 -0.18%
2021 55,800,000 -1.24%
2022 56,700,000 +1.61%
2023 55,300,000 -2.47%
2024 51,200,000 -7.41%
2025 50,300,000 -1.76%

Key Metric Definitions

  • Dividend Yield: Annual dividend per share divided by current share price.
  • Dividend Growth Rate: Compound annual growth rate of annual dividend per share over the last 5 years.
  • Payout Ratio: Percentage of earnings paid as dividends (TTM).
  • Payout Consistency: % of eligible periods with uninterrupted or increased dividends, measured over the entire lifetime of the stock or fund.
  • Payout Frequency: Number of dividends paid per year (typically quarterly).
  • Overall Dividend Rating: Proprietary composite score, quantified on a scale from 0 to +100. Ratings surpassing 70 are regarded as favorable, while those exceeding 85 are strong.
  • Total Return: Price appreciation plus dividends over specified period.
  • Market Cap: Figures are in millions of the corresponding currency.
